The Local Culture of Southwest Asia
The culture of Southwest Asia is incredibly diverse, with each country and region having its own unique traditions and customs. One common thread is the importance of hospitality and generosity towards guests. In many parts of Southwest Asia, it's customary to offer guests tea or coffee as a sign of welcome.

The History of Southwest Asia
Southwest Asia is home to some of the world's oldest civilizations, including Mesopotamia and the Persian Empire. Visitors can explore ancient ruins, such as the city of Babylon in Iraq and the Achaemenid capital of Persepolis in Iran. Additionally, the region has played a significant role in shaping world history, with events such as the Crusades and the rise of Islam.
